WHAT IS II VI chord progression?

ii-V-I. A ii-V-I is the most commonly use chord progression in Jazz; you’ll find it in almost every (Tonal) Jazz Standard. It provides a strong sense of finality and establishes the the tonic chord. This is because we are moving through a functional Pre-Dominant → Dominant → Tonic chord progression.

What does II mean in music theory?

It is a succession of chords whose roots descend in fifths from the second degree (supertonic) to the fifth degree (dominant), and finally to the tonic. In a major key, the supertonic triad (ii) is minor, and in a minor key it is diminished.

What is the most common chord progression?

The I–V–vi–IV progression is a common chord progression popular across several genres of music. It involves the I, V, vi, and IV chords of any particular musical scale. For example, in the key of C major, this progression would be: C–G–Am–F.

What is the V chord?

The v chord, when derived from the notes of the natural minor scale, falls as a minor triad or minor 7th chord. For example, in the key of A Minor the chord built on the fifth of the scale is an Em (E G B) or Em7 (E G B D). The notes in these chords all come from the A natural minor scale.
